Zippy Beetle is a charming early reader book designed for children ages 5 to 8. It combines engaging board book features with playful fiction and novelty elements like die-cut shapes to capture young readers' attention. This book is perfect for early literacy development and encourages curiosity through a fun, tactile reading experience.
